This paper reviews a wide range of issues and major changes in the 4th stage of UK's community care development, for over 20 years. Several new implementation tools were introduced since the National Health Service and Community Care Act 1990. This act had given the lead agency role to social services authorities for all the main core groups of service users and actively required the stimulation of a mixed economy of care. At a strategic level, this was achieved through wide consultation with diverse service professionals on the basis of care management, user empowerment, care continuum with the emphasis upon the leading role of primary care within the community. In addition, supports and assessment for carers, and integrated care system were the focus of continuous attention. Although service rationing and dilution was also in the center of concern under the budget constraints, UK's community care service scheme has surely been advanced in terms of inter-departments coordination, quality control, and the supply of a wide scope of health and social services. Through this review, useful guidance for Korean society is drawn as follows: improvement of early intervention and user empowerment, more extensive use of assistive technology including telecare and monitoring, growth of nonprofit sector suppliers, tailored joint-service provision of health and social care, enhancing the autonomy of local governments, promoting a more flexible work environment for diverse professionals, and finally necessity of comprehensive supports for carers.
